    Real-World Examples of Essaere of Leaks

    To truly understand the impact of essaere of leaks, let's look at some real-world examples:

    Example 1: The Equifax Breach

    In 2017, credit reporting agency Equifax suffered one of the largest data breaches in history. The breach exposed the personal information of over 147 million people, including Social Security numbers, birth dates, and addresses. The fallout was massive, with Equifax facing lawsuits and regulatory fines totaling billions of dollars.

    Example 2: The Facebook-Cambridge Analytica Scandal

    This infamous case involved the improper sharing of data belonging to millions of Facebook users. Cambridge Analytica, a political consulting firm, harvested this data without consent, using it to influence election campaigns. The scandal led to increased scrutiny of Facebook's data practices and calls for stricter regulations.

    Legal Implications of Essaere of Leaks

    When it comes to essaere of leaks, there are significant legal ramifications for those involved. Companies found responsible for breaches may face hefty fines and lawsuits. In some cases, executives can even be held personally liable for negligence.

    Regulations like the General Data Protection Regulation (GDPR) in Europe and the California Consumer Privacy Act (CCPA) in the U.S. have been implemented to protect consumer data. These laws require organizations to implement robust security measures and notify affected individuals in the event of a breach.

    Future Trends in Data Security

    As we look to the future, several trends are emerging in the field of data security:

    • Zero Trust Architecture: This approach assumes that no one, inside or outside the network, can be trusted. It requires continuous verification of identity and access rights.
    • Quantum Computing: While still in development, quantum computing has the potential to revolutionize encryption and cybersecurity.
    • Behavioral Analytics: By analyzing user behavior, systems can detect anomalies that may indicate a breach.

    These innovations will play a critical role in shaping the future of data protection.
